We consider a generalised Maxwell-Einstein system in a higher dimensional space-time such that the energy-momentum tensor is traceless. After reduction to four dimensions and setting the gauge fields equal to zero, we obtain the usual four dimensional Einstein-Hilbert term coupled to two scalar fields. One of them is a Brans-Dicke type scalar field with an inverted sign of the kinetic term. The obtained cosmological solutions are non-singular.
